ZIP code 31787 is located in Smithville, Georgia, within Lee County. With a population of 1,321, this is a sparsely populated ZIP code with a middle-aged community — the median age is 41.5 years. Economically, 31787 is a middle-income ZIP code: the median household income of $76,120 is near the national average.
Real estate in ZIP code 31787 represents an affordable housing market. The median home value of $236,600 is below the national average. Renters can expect to pay around $921 per month in median rent. Homeownership is strong here — 78.8% of occupied units are owner-occupied, suggesting an established, stable residential community. Median home values have increased by 151% since 2019.
The population of 31787 is primarily White (78.58%). Residents are moderately educated — 31.6%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is below the national average. Poverty affects some residents at 13.0%. Household income has grown by 131% since 2019.
About 12% of workers are remote.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 72%.
Overall, ZIP code 31787 in Smithville, GA is characterized as middle-income, moderately educated, a middle-aged community, and predominantly owner-occupied.
